What’s SERP Got to Do with It?

If you type “design blogs” into an incognito search in Google, there are

over one-billion SERP returns. I recommend that you add a secondary

subject to your niche to make yourself stand out. My tag comes up

on page 2 of a “literary design” search with over 119,000,000 results.

Write Well and Long for Google

I am often asked why I write such long posts—

the point being that people don’t have time to

read these days. I write them so Google will respect my content

enough to crawl my site often and rank me highly on the subjects I cover.

TIPS and TO-DOs• Know where you stand by doing an incognito search on Chrome, and

putting in your blog name and phrases of subjects you write about. • A minimum of 300 words per post and 500 words is even better for

ranking on Google.• Study the Hummingbird, Panda and Penguin tweaks on MOZ.com to

understand how to improve your relevance.• Properly manage categories and tags so that you rank well. Add the SEO

Yoast plugin to your site to learn how.• Pay close attention to titles to give yourself a leg-up.• When you are strategizing your posts, think about how they might flow

into a book and come out of your efforts with a published work to show for it; for any long piece like that, do yourself a favor and hire an editor.
